Olympic culture to be reviewed in Shenyang

<h4>Source: CCTV.com</h4><h4>04-09-2008 09:16</h4><p>Hand in hand with the upcoming Beijing Olympics, the culture of the world's greatest sports event will be reviewed at an exhibition in northeast China's Shenyang, a co-host of this summer's Games. </p><p>The exhibition, granted by Beijing Olympic Organizing Committee, will unfold a panoramic view of previous Olympics by displaying Olympic medals, torches, posters, official mascots, souvenirs and wax figurines of athletes. A variety of methods will be used, including material, pictures, videos, and 4D technology. To take visitors down memory lane are clips of past Games, and the life stories of the people who helped develop the Games and spread the Olympic spirit. The exhibition will start from June 23rd and run for over three months. </p><p>There will also be some events associated with the exhibition, including a walking race,a fishing competition,ten thousand people running in a ten thousand-meter race, as well as bicycle racing. The aim is to connect the competitive Olympics with general sporting activities. </p>
